Web6 apr. 2024 · A good raised garden bed soil mix will be a combination of topsoil, compost or organic matter, and sand or grit. The combination creates a soil that has good drainage and holds onto water and nutrients, while providing all the vital nutrients for the plants. Around 30-50% of the make-up of the soil can be composed of compost, topped up with ... There are three main ways to take a cutting … shared hope international careersWeb22 jun. 2024 · Take cuttings from healthy, lanky stems, ideally when you're cutting it back anyway to encourage thick, bushy growth. Trim the bottom leaves from 4- to 6- inch cuttings, making a clean cut just below a leaf node.
